chinese state circus mulan THU 20 & FRI 21 JAN Thu 8pm, Fri 5pm & 8pm C g l From the land of legends and warrior Shaolin monks comes the incredible new Chinese State Circus production – the live acrobatic spectacular - Mulan. A breathtaking fusion of precision acrobatics, Shaolin martial arts, dazzling circus skills, colourful characters from Peking Opera, physical theatre and drama choreographed to an original music score, Mulan is based on the legend of one of China’s greatest heroines. Entertainment for all the family - from the world’s leading Chinese acrobats. From gravity-defying gymnastics to the seemingly impossible body manipulations of the hand-balancer; from the leaping, rolling somersaulting repertoire of the hoop divers to the lavish tradition of the Lion Dance – the undisputed masters of physical theatre will have the audience on the edge of their seats.

Lyrics by Tim Rice Music by Andrew Lloyd Webber Presented by York Stage Musicals in association with The Really Useful Group Director Robert Readman Musical Director Adam Tomlinson Inspired by the political and personal struggles between Judas Iscariot and Jesus Christ, this spectacular musical follows the last seven days in the life of Jesus Christ, beginning with the preparations for his arrival in Jerusalem and ending with his crucifixion. Originally written as a concept rock-opera album by Andrew Lloyd Webber and Tim Rice, Jesus Christ Superstar exploded onto the Broadway stage in 1971 earning itself five Tony Award nominations by the following year. Now celebrating its fortieth anniversary, the show has gone on to become one of the greatest and most enduring musicals of all time. From the classic Lloyd Webber score, songs include: Hosanna, Gethsemane, Everything’s Alright, I Don’t Know How To Love Him, Heaven On Their Minds and the title song itself Superstar.

niki evans as Mrs Johnstone Written by Willy Russell, the legendary Blood Brothers tells the captivating and moving tale of twins who, separated at birth, grow up on opposite sides of the tracks, only to meet again with tragic consequences. Starring X Factor’s Niki Evans as Mrs Johnstone, the superb score includes Bright New Day, Marilyn Monroe and the emotionally charged hit Tell Me It’s Not True. Few musicals have received quite such acclaim as the multi-award-winning Blood Brothers, and this production, having recently celebrated its 21st phenomenal year in London, continues to enjoy standing ovations at every devastating performance. Ambassador theatre group Grand Opera House, York is operated by the Ambassador Theatre Group (ATG), who have a total of 39 venues across the UK, including 12 in the West End, and 27 regionally. ATG’s impressive portfolio of West End theatres includes Apollo Victoria, Comedy, Donmar Warehouse, Duke of York’s, Fortune, Lyceum, Phoenix, Piccadilly, Playhouse, Savoy, Trafalgar Studio 1 and Trafalgar Studio 2. ATG’s regional theatres include The Ambassadors Woking encompassing the New Victoria and Rhoda McGaw Theatres and the award-winning Ambassador Cinemas; Alexandra Theatre, Aylesbury Waterside Theatre; Birmingham; Theatre Royal Brighton; Bristol Hippodrome; Churchill Theatre Bromley; Edinburgh Playhouse; Leas Cliff Hall, Folkestone; King’s Theatre and Theatre Royal, Glasgow; Grimsby Auditorium; Liverpool Empire; Palace Theatre and Opera House, Manchester; Milton Keynes Theatre; New Theatre, Oxford; Richmond Theatre; Southport Theatre; Regent Theatre and Victoria Hall, Stokeon-Trent; Sunderland Empire; Princess Theatre, Torquay; New Wimbledon Theatre and New Wimbledon Studio; Grand Opera House, York. ATG is also one of the country’s foremost theatre producers, in Britain and internationally. Current and recent ATG co-productions include The Misanthrope starring Damian Lewis and Keira Knightley; Legally Blonde, West Side Story, Guys and Dolls, Andrew Lloyd Webber’s Sunset Boulevard and Spamalot.
